What is the Mahindra Vision T?

The Mahindra Vision T is a sneak peek into the future of Mahindra’s SUV lineup. Unveiled on August 15, 2025, this rugged yet stylish five-door SUV is built to appeal to both adventure seekers and city drivers. It’s not just another concept car—it’s a bold statement of Mahindra’s plans to dominate the C-segment luxury SUV market both in India and globally.

The Mahindra Vision T boasts Mahindra’s evolved Heartcore design language, which means it’s got a tough, muscular look with modern touches. Think wide, multi-slot grille, sleek LED DRLs, a high bonnet, and chunky bumpers with a bright tow hook. The side profile screams adventure with flat panels, squared wheel arches, and chunky all-terrain tires, while the rear sports vertical LED tail lamps and a spare wheel for that true off-road vibe. Why the Mahindra Vision T Stands Out

What sets the Mahindra Vision T apart from other SUVs in its class? For starters, it’s built on Mahindra’s brand-new NU_IQ platform, a modular, multi-energy architecture that’s as flexible as it gets. This platform allows the Vision T to offer multiple powertrain options—petrol, diesel, hybrid, or even fully electric. Whether you prefer front-wheel drive (FWD), all-wheel drive (AWD), or need a left-hand drive (LHD) or right-hand drive (RHD) setup for global markets, the Mahindra Vision T has you covered.

The interior is another highlight. Expect a spacious cabin with a flat floor for extra legroom, high seating for a commanding view, and ample boot space for all your gear. It’s designed to cater to both lifestyle buyers who want a sleek daily driver and hardcore off-roaders who need a vehicle that can handle tough terrain. With production models expected to hit the roads by 2027, the Vision T is poised to compete with the likes of the Mahindra Thar Roxx while being priced more affordably, in the range of ₹12-22 lakh (ex-showroom).

The NU_IQ Platform: Mahindra’s Secret Weapon

The real game-changer behind the Mahindra Vision T is the NU_IQ platform. Revealed alongside four SUV concepts—Vision S, Vision T, Vision SXT, and Vision X—this modular platform is Mahindra’s ticket to global success. So, what makes it so special?

A Platform Built for the Future

The NU_IQ platform is designed to be versatile, supporting a wide range of body styles, powertrains, and drive configurations. Whether it’s a compact SUV like the Mahindra Vision T, a rugged pickup like the Vision SXT, or a lifestyle SUV like the Vision T, this platform can handle it all. It’s engineered to meet global safety and emission standards, making it ready for markets beyond India, from South Africa to Europe and beyond.

Mahindra’s focus on flexibility means the NU_IQ platform can support electric SUVs, hybrids, and traditional petrol or diesel engines. This is a big deal in today’s world, where carmakers need to adapt to changing regulations and consumer preferences. Plus, with Mahindra planning to add a 2.4 lakh-unit capacity at a new facility near Nashik, they’re gearing up to produce these SUVs in huge numbers starting in 2027.

Global Ambitions with a ‘Made in India’ Heart

Mahindra isn’t just thinking about India with the NU_IQ platform—they’re aiming for the world. The company’s CEO, Anish Shah, emphasized that these SUVs are “engineered in India, for India and the world.” With a new assembly plant in South Africa and an upgraded facility in Chakan, Mahindra is ready to take on global giants like Toyota, Hyundai, and Kia. The Vision series, powered by NU_IQ, is set to challenge C-segment luxury vehicles head-on, offering premium features at competitive prices.

What Else Was Revealed?

While the Vision T stole the spotlight, Mahindra also showcased three other concepts at the Freedom_NU event:

  • Vision S: A compact SUV with a modern, urban vibe, likely a next-gen Mahindra Bolero.
  • Vision SXT: A rugged four-door pickup based on the Thar E concept, complete with two spare wheels on the bed for serious off-roaders.
  • Vision X: A sub-4-meter SUV that could be an upgraded version of the XUV 3XO, aimed at younger buyers.

Each of these concepts is built on the NU_IQ platform, showcasing its versatility. From compact city SUVs to tough pickups, Mahindra is covering all bases to appeal to a wide range of drivers.
